WebGraphite. Again the carbon atoms are bonded together to make a giant structure but in this case all of the carbons are bonded to only three neighbour and are sp 2 hybridised. As the sp 2 hybridisation results in planar structures, there are giant 2 dimensional layers of carbon atoms and each layer is only weakly linked to the next layer by Van der Waal's … WebGraphene has a giant covalent structure, but fullerenes have large molecules. WebFullerene is an allotrope of carbon with 60 carbon atoms in the molecule. It is not a giant structure (C 60 is just not that large when compared to 'real' giant structures, such as graphite and diamond). It was first isolated …

WebAug 31, 2024 · Crystals of diamond contain only carbon atoms, and these are linked to each other by covalent bonds in a giant three-dimensional network, as shown below. Note how each carbon atom is surrounded tetrahedrally by four bonds.
